1878-1967. English poet and novelist. Early volumes of poetry such as Salt Water Ballads 1902 were followed by The Everlasting Mercy 1911, a long verse narrative characterized by its forcefully colloquial language, and Reynard the Fox 1919. His other works include the novel Sard Harker 1924, the critical work Badon Parchments 1947, the children's book The Box of Delights 1935, and plays. He was poet laureate from 1930.
